Derived Measurements Extended Response
Mark's heart beats 16 times in 15 seconds. At that rate, how many times will it beat in one minute?
There are 60 seconds in 1 minute and 15 seconds is 1/4 of 60. So, since it takes 15 four times to go to 60, you multiply 16 and 4, and you get 64. Therefore, the answer is 64 beats per minute.
